JOB SUMMARY:
The Fulfillment Coordinator is an integral part of the reservations team and is responsible for coordinating the preparation, production and distribution of all guest documents related to the bookings of the Central Reservation Department. D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ES Be able to operate Windows based applications as well as web based programs. Works in the Fulfillment Assembly queue to record actions taken. Assemble confirmations with appropriate inserts; insurance brochure, central reservations brochures, tickets and vouchers, etc., as booked. Prepare reservations for Will Call/Concierge Perform quality assurance processes reviewing all reservations for accuracy, tracking reservation booking and fulfillment issues, and assisting with resolutions and agent education. Coordinate reservation and travel document tracking and fulfillment, including printing and processing confirmations, tickets and vouchers for various activity and service reservation components. Regularly check the Accounting Audit Queue for specific reservation fulfillment comments from agents and supervisors for a reservation related issue. Follow steps to assure the appropriate person is notified or make the requested changes. Answer fulfillment questions regarding ticketing, confirmations and reservations from clients, sales agents and vendors. Void or make changes with above tickets in Sirius, after canceling or adding additional products. Reconcile the amount to be refunded or charged to the guest. If there is an additional payment due, make payment in reservation.
